CIJ Renault Nervasport toy racing car in tin 1930 35CM Renault NERVASPORT mechanical wind-up racing car with key in orange tin, rubber wheels. Length 35 cm Height 9 cm No key, I have not tried to wind the spring, everything is original and in its original condition. Price not negotiable. Payment by check or bank transfer. The tapered and very streamlined body is extremely narrow, with a fastback rear, supported by a wooden frame. It was designed by Marcel Riffard, an aeronautical engineer from the Caudron aircraft company (bought by Renault in 1933) and inspired by the fuselages of his racing planes (speed records, with Renault aircraft engines) Caudron-Renault C.362 (1933), and Caudron-Renault C.460 (1934)… It is powered by an 8-cylinder in-line engine from the Renault Nervasport and Renault Nervastella (the most powerful of the brand) of 4.8 L for 108 horsepower, and nearly 200 km/h top speed. Partial achievements: 1932: 2nd in the Monte Carlo Rally, Renault Nervasport version. 1934: 3 world records, on April 4 and 5 (in its 3 to 5 L displacement category) after 48 hours 3 min and 14 s of racing on the Linas-Montlhéry autodrome, near Paris, including 8037 km in 48 h at an average speed of 167.445 km/h, with refueling of 35 s7, and average speed records over 4000 and 5000 miles, Renault Nervasport version of the Records 1935: victory in the Monte Carlo Rally, Renault Nerva Grand Sport CS Coupé Spécial version. 1935: victory in the Liège-Rome-Liège, tied with Bugatti, Renault Nervasport version 1935: 2nd in the Morocco Rally
